The E-Bike City project explores how reallocating up to 50% of urban road space to micromobility (primarily conventional bicycles, e-bikes (up to 25kph) and speed pedelecs (up to 45kph)) affects accessibility in cities with more than 50,000 inhabitants.

The E-Bike Potential: Estimating regional e-bike impacts on greenhouse gas emissions
Transportation Research Part D: Transport and Environment, 2020Abstract Electric bicycles (e-bikes) have been found to offer a promising solution to reduce the greenhouse gas (GHG) impact of a region’s passenger transportation system. Using data from a North American survey of e-bike owners, a mode replacement model was adapted and augmented to consider the case of Portland, OR for various levels of e-bike ...

Evaluation of e-bike accidents in Switzerland
Accident Analysis & Prevention, 2014The acceptance and usage of electric bicycles has rapidly increased in Switzerland in the last years. Hence this topic has been addressed by policy makers with the aim to facilitate new transport modes and, moreover, to improve their safety.Police-recorded accidents of the years 2011 and 2012 involving a total of 504 e-bikers and 871 bicyclists were ...
